The KSTRONG AtexWorX Shock Absorbing Lanyard is specially designed for use in potentially explosive environments, making it an ideal choice for industries like mining, petrochemicals, and confined spaces. It incorporates anti-static webbing and a shock absorber cover to prevent electrostatic discharge that could ignite an explosive atmosphere.
The lanyard comes with a 44mm wide polyester webbing, featuring high-tenacity conductive thread for added safety. Equipped with aluminum snap and scaffold hooks, it ensures a secure connection while being lightweight for easy handling. The 1.8-meter length offers flexibility and freedom of movement. This lanyard complies with multiple certifications, including EN 355:2002 and ATEX 2014/34/EU, ensuring reliable protection in hazardous conditions.
Key Features:
- Anti-Static Webbing: Prevents electrostatic discharge in explosive environments.
- Aluminum Connectors: Includes aluminum snap hook and scaffold hooks for secure attachment.
- Shock Absorber: Integrated anti-static shock absorber for impact reduction.
- Durable Construction: 44mm wide polyester webbing with high-tenacity conduction thread.
- Certifications: EN 355:2002, ATEX 2014/34/EU, EN ISO 80079-36:2016, EN ISO 80079-37:2016, EN 1149-1:2006, EN 1149-5:2008.

Standards and Planning Notes
For Malaysia and Singapore projects, fall protection equipment should be selected through a work-at-height risk assessment, checked against relevant EN/ANSI/Singapore Standard references where applicable, and supported by inspection records. Malaysia buyers should also confirm DOSH/SIRIM KPD documentation for safety harnesses, lifelines and related components where required.

Can this be used alone?
Fall protection products should not be treated as standalone protection unless the full system is compatible. Check the harness, connector, anchor, fall clearance, training and rescue procedure together.
